![]() Matt’s Big Breakfast (B5): Local favorite offering all-day breakfast, including the Five Spot Platter breakfast sandwich with eggs, bacon and cheese. ![]() Wendy’s (B4): Popular restaurant chain known for its burgers and fries. Pita Jungle (B3): Offers healthy food such as pitas, wraps, salads and hummus. Cowboy Ciao also has a full service restaurant near gate B21. B gatesĬowboy Ciao Express (B1): A grab-and-go kiosk with sandwiches, beverages and snacks. Tammie Coe To Go (A22): Grab-and-go with sandwiches, drinks and sweets from Tammie Coe Cakes. Pei Wei (A23): Airport location of the chain of Asian diners, the sister company of P.F. Also has locations in the terminal pre-security and near gate D1.įour Peaks Brewery (A20): The Arizona brewery's Sky Harbor location serves a selection of bar food like cheeseburgers, grilled chicken sandwiches and chicken enchiladas, as well as a selection of its beers.ĭeluxburger (A22): Quick service restaurant specializing in burgers. Peet's Coffee & Tea (A17): Coffee shop serving coffee and tea. Wildflower also has a location in the terminal pre-security. Wildflower Bread Company (A8): Serves breakfast in the morning and a selection of sandwiches, salads and soups at lunch and dinner. ![]() ![]() Panda Express (A8): Airport location of the popular Chinese restaurant chain serves food like teriyaki chicken, egg rolls and fried rice. Blanco, as well as the previously mentioned Olive & Ivy and Zinburger, are among restaurateur Sam Fox's many concepts with a presence in metro Phoenix.ĭilly's Deli (A7 and A17): The airport locations of this Tempe deli offers prepackaged sandwiches and salads for on-the-go travelers. Zinburger (A4): Zinburger is a go-to for American comfort food, serving several varieties of burgers, chicken sandwiches and shakes.īlanco Tacos & Tequila (A5): Blanco Tacos' menu includes many of the taco specialties they're known for at their metro Phoenix restaurant locations, including green chile pork, braised short rib and carne asada tacos. Olive & Ivy (A4): This airport offshoot of the Scottsdale Mediterranean restaurant serves paninis, salads and specialty coffees. Zinc Brasserie also operates a full-service restaurant near gate C11. Zinc Brasserie Grab & Go (A1): A grab-and-go spot serving French sandwiches.
